Informatica Intelligent Data Management Cloud and Studio Creatio both compete in data management and business process automation. Informatica IDMC appears to have the upper hand due to its advanced data integration and AI-driven insights.
Features: IDMC offers powerful data integration and governance, AI-driven insights, and real-time data streaming integration with solutions like Hadoop and NoSQL. Studio Creatio provides a low-code/no-code platform that simplifies business process automation with built-in machine learning capabilities to enhance customer interactions and data management.
Room for Improvement: Informatica IDMC could enhance its UI for better intuitiveness, address streaming stability in cloud environments, and improve legacy data integrations. Studio Creatio needs improvements in UI customization, multi-data source integrations, and a more robust HRM solution for environments demanding high customization.
Ease of Deployment and Customer Service: IDMC is often deployed in hybrid cloud environments to leverage its integration capabilities within complex systems, with generally good technical support but variable response times. Studio Creatio is noted for its flexible deployment options and acclaimed for responsive customer service with effective communication.
Pricing and ROI: Informatica IDMC is positioned at a higher price point, justifying its cost with features beneficial for large enterprises, offering scalability and strong ROI through improved data quality and reduced processing times. Studio Creatio is a cost-effective alternative with competitive pricing providing good ROI for businesses seeking efficient process automation without significant upfront investment.

In on-premise, we call it EDC for metadata management, while in cloud-based technologies, it is known as the Metadata Command Center, which serves the same purpose as EDC concerning CDGC.
Informatica Intelligent Data Management Cloud (IDMC) is a robust platform used by banks, financial institutions, and health sector organizations for data management, governance, and compliance.
IDMC provides comprehensive tools for data discovery, profiling, masking, and transformation. It supports Salesforce integration, real-time data streaming, and scalable data management solutions. Health organizations manage national product catalogs while financial entities focus on data protection and regulatory compliance.
